Wildfire burns 8 acres in West Marin

About eight acres of brush burned Thursday in Olema, near the junction of Sir Francis Drake Boulevard and Shoreline Highway in West Marin. The fire started around 4:25 p.m. on the road on the south side of Sir Francis Drake Boulevard in grassy oak woodlands, said the Marin County Fire Department. The fire was 30 percent contained within about two hours. Five engines, two water tenders, one bulldozer, one medic unit, and two battalion chiefs responded to the scene from the county and Inverness departments. CalFire aircraft also responded.
